"Kuslevova Kuća – in this house at the beginning of the 20th century. The first professional dentist of Montenegro, Risto KUSLEV (Macedonian, born in Greece in 1887), lived and worked. At the invitation of King Nikola Petrovic, Risto came to Montenegro in 1913 to work for the royal family. In 1916, the doctor bought a house in Podgorica and started a private dental practice here, also teaching future dentists. This earned him the respect and love of the townspeople. The mansion survived the bombings of World War II. Today, the Kuslev House is one of the centers of cultural life in Podgorica, where exhibitions and concerts are held.
On October 10, 2024, my family and I visited this cozy mansion at the opening of the exhibition of Montenegrin graphic artist Maria Kapisoda “Echoes of the Earth – psychological landscapes”
🍃 Marija Kapisoda “Eho zemlje – psihološki pejzaži”
The works were performed using lithography technique. The landscape images of the paintings reflect something unsaid, elusive - something that is hidden in the subconscious... I wanted to stop at each work and take a closer look - each one “resonated” in its own way. In the exhibition space, some of the lithographs are collected in duets and trios, where similar compositions reflect different facets of the image.
The exhibition left a mark on my memory!"

Kuslev House is centrally located in Podgorica, making it easily accessible by foot from the city center. Local buses also serve the surrounding area. Parking might be limited, so consider public transport or walking if you're nearby.
Information on wheelchair accessibility is not widely available. It's recommended to contact the venue directly to inquire about ramp access or any limitations within the historic building.

The Legacy of Dr. Risto Kuslev
The mansion itself is a testament to its resilience, having survived the bombings of World War II. This survival adds another layer to its historical narrative, making it a symbol of endurance and continuity in Podgorica. Today, the house stands not just as a memorial to Dr. Kuslev but as a living monument to the city's past.
